1. Lightweight and Breathable Clothing:

When it comes to navigating the scorching summer heat of Dubai, your choice of clothing can make all the difference in staying cool and comfortable. Opting for lightweight and breathable options is a crucial strategy for a pleasant experience under the blazing sun.

One practical option to consider is linen blends. Linen, known for its breathability and moisture-wicking properties, is a natural fabric that ensures you stay cool in the heat. Linen-blend shirts, dresses, and trousers are not only fashionable but also resistant to wrinkles, ensuring you look sharp even as the temperature rises. The natural texture of linen adds a touch of sophistication to your ensemble, making it an ideal choice for your Dubai wardrobe.

Another excellent choice for staying cool and stylish in Dubai's summer is to embrace the comfort of maxi dresses and flowy skirts. Maxi dresses offer full coverage while allowing air to circulate freely, providing a practical and elegant solution for daytime explorations and evening outings alike. Flowy skirts, on the other hand, provide freedom of movement and a feminine touch, offering a stylish alternative to pants in the heat. These options are versatile, easily paired with comfortable sandals for daytime adventures or accessorized for a more polished look in the evening.

When selecting clothing for Dubai's summer, consider the importance of light colors. Opting for whites, pastels, and neutrals not only contributes to a chic and stylish appearance but also helps reflect the sun's rays rather than absorbing them. Additionally, choosing loose-fitting garments promotes air circulation around your body, aiding in heat dissipation and ensuring a more comfortable experience in the high temperatures.

2. Sunscreen and Hydration Essentials:

In the blazing heat of Dubai's summer, maintaining your skin's health and ensuring proper hydration are paramount for a comfortable and enjoyable experience. 

Dubai's intense sun demands reliable sun protection, and water-infused sunscreens emerge as a fantastic option. These formulations not only shield your skin from harmful UV rays but also provide a refreshing and hydrating sensation. The added water content contributes to a cooling effect, making the application of sunscreen a more pleasant experience in the heat. Beyond sun protection, water-infused sunscreens often come with additional moisturizing properties, beneficial in Dubai's dry climate to combat potential skin dehydration, ensuring your skin stays supple and hydrated throughout the day.

Staying hydrated in the Dubai heat is non-negotiable, and a collapsible water bottle is a practical solution. Its space-saving design allows you to easily stow it away in your bag when not in use. This feature is particularly handy for travelers, ensuring you always have a water bottle on hand without sacrificing precious luggage space. The convenience of filling up your bottle is enhanced by Dubai's well-equipped water stations across the city. Whether you're exploring vibrant neighborhoods or iconic landmarks, having a reliable water source at your fingertips ensures you can beat the heat and stay refreshed at all times.

Set regular reminders to stay hydrated throughout the day, as the combination of high temperatures and outdoor activities can lead to increased fluid loss. Additionally, consider adding electrolyte packs to your water for an extra boost. These packs can help replenish essential minerals lost through sweating, ensuring your body stays well-nourished and energized in the heat.

3. Adapters and Power Banks:

When embarking on a summer trip to Dubai, ensuring that your electronic devices stay charged is essential for a seamless and well-connected experience. 

Investing in an all-in-one universal adapter is a savvy choice for the diverse electrical outlets you may encounter in Dubai. Opt for a model equipped with multiple USB ports, allowing you to charge multiple devices simultaneously without the need for carrying multiple adapters. This versatile solution simplifies the charging process and ensures compatibility with various plug types, offering convenience during your exploration of the city's attractions.

Consider taking advantage of Dubai's abundant sunlight with a solar-powered power bank. This eco-friendly charging option harnesses solar energy to keep your devices charged on the go. The city's sun-drenched climate provides ample opportunities for your power bank to soak up sunlight, offering a sustainable and reliable source of energy for your devices. This not only aligns with eco-conscious practices but also ensures that you can capture every moment and navigate the city without worrying about running out of battery.

In addition to these practical options, it's wise to consider the compact and lightweight nature of these devices, making them easy to carry in your daypack or pocket. As Dubai offers a plethora of attractions and experiences, from modern marvels to cultural gems, having your devices fully charged enhances your ability to document your journey, navigate with ease, and stay connected throughout your stay.

4. Lightweight Rain Gear:

When preparing for a summer trip to Dubai, it's crucial to be ready for unexpected rain showers, even though the region is known for its arid climate. Opting for a compact rain poncho is a smart choice for staying prepared without adding bulk to your luggage. These lightweight and foldable ponchos easily fit into your daypack, ensuring you're always ready for unexpected rain showers. The compact design allows for quick and hassle-free deployment when needed, providing instant coverage to keep you dry without taking up valuable space in your bag. Whether you're exploring the city's markets or visiting cultural sites, having a compact rain poncho on hand ensures you can continue your adventure without being deterred by a sudden downpour.

Upgrading your daypack to a water-repellent or waterproof option adds an extra layer of protection for your essentials. A sudden rain shower can catch you off guard, and having a backpack that repels water ensures that your belongings stay dry and protected. Look for features such as sealed seams, water-resistant zippers, and a durable water-repellent (DWR) coating to enhance the bag's resistance to moisture. This way, you can confidently carry your valuables, electronics, and travel documents without worrying about them getting soaked in an unexpected rainstorm.

Additionally, consider the size and capacity of the backpack, ensuring it can accommodate your essentials while remaining compact and easy to carry. A water-repellent backpack not only safeguards your belongings from rain but also proves useful in protecting them from dust and sand in Dubai's dynamic environment.

5. Modest Attire for Cultural Sites:

When exploring the rich cultural and religious sites in Dubai, it's essential to dress respectfully and modestly. 

For women, opting for lightweight abayas is a respectful and culturally appropriate choice when visiting mosques and other religious sites. Abayas are loose-fitting, full-length garments that provide coverage and modesty. Choosing breathable fabrics like cotton or linen ensures that you stay cool despite the warm temperatures. The loose design allows for air circulation, making abayas comfortable for extended periods of wear. For men, kanduras offer a traditional and modest outfit. These ankle-length garments are typically made from lightweight fabrics, providing both cultural appropriateness and comfort in Dubai's climate.

For added flexibility, consider convertible pants that can easily transform into shorts. This practical option allows you to adapt your clothing to different environments and weather conditions while still adhering to modest dress codes. Lightweight, breathable fabrics such as quick-drying nylon or moisture-wicking blends are ideal for staying comfortable during your cultural explorations. Additionally, bringing a lightweight scarf is a versatile accessory that can be used to cover your shoulders when visiting religious sites. This simple addition to your attire ensures you can easily comply with dress codes and show respect for the local customs.

When selecting clothing for cultural excursions, it's advisable to choose light colors to reflect the sun's rays, and loose-fitting options to promote airflow. This not only respects local traditions but also enhances your overall comfort in Dubai's warm climate.

6. Swimsuit and Beach Essentials:

When the sun in Dubai is shining high and the inviting waters of the Arabian Gulf beckon, it's time to hit the beaches in style. 

A beach day in Dubai wouldn't be complete without a dip in the crystal-clear waters. Opt for a quick-dry microfiber towel for your beach outings. These towels are designed to absorb water rapidly and dry fast, allowing you to stay dry and comfortable without the hassle of carrying around a heavy, wet towel. Their compact size also makes them ideal for beach trips, taking up minimal space in your beach bag while providing maximum functionality. Whether you're lounging on the sand or enjoying a swim in the Gulf, a quick-dry microfiber towel ensures you can stay refreshed and dry throughout the day.

Shield yourself from the sun's intense rays with a stylish and practical foldable beach hat. This accessory not only adds a touch of glamour to your beach ensemble but also provides essential sun protection for your face and neck. The foldable design makes it easy to pack and carry, ensuring you can enjoy the beach without sacrificing your style. Look for a hat with a wide brim to offer optimal shade, and consider materials like straw or lightweight fabric for breathability. Whether you're strolling along the shoreline or sipping a refreshing drink at a beachside cafe, a foldable beach hat is a must-have accessory for both fashion and function.

As you plan for your beach escapades, remember to include other essentials such as a high SPF sunscreen, a swimsuit that suits your style and comfort, and a beach bag to carry your belongings. Additionally, consider a reusable water bottle to stay hydrated under the sun.

7. Travel Documents and Essentials:

Investing in a travel wallet equipped with RFID protection is a smart move to keep your sensitive information secure. RFID (Radio-Frequency Identification) technology is commonly used in credit cards and passports, making them susceptible to electronic theft. A travel wallet with RFID protection features a special lining that blocks unauthorized scans, safeguarding your cards and personal information from potential cyber threats. This not only provides peace of mind but also ensures that your financial and identification details are protected as you explore the vibrant city of Dubai.

In the digital age, having physical copies of your important documents is essential, but it's equally crucial to have digital backups. Create digital copies of your passport, visa, flight tickets, hotel reservations, and any other vital documents. Store these copies in the cloud or on a secure online platform, ensuring that you can access them from any device with an internet connection. This precautionary step acts as a safeguard in case your physical documents are lost or misplaced during your travels. It's a convenient way to have a backup plan and expedite any necessary procedures, such as reporting lost documents or verifying reservations.

Use organizational pouches within your travel wallet to categorize different types of documents. This ensures easy access and keeps everything in order, preventing the hassle of rummaging through your wallet when needed. If using cloud storage or online platforms, ensure that your accounts have strong, secure passwords. Consider enabling two-factor authentication for an added layer of protection.

By incorporating a travel wallet with RFID protection and utilizing digital copies stored in the cloud, you're taking practical steps to safeguard your travel documents during your summer journey to Dubai. These options not only enhance the security of your valuable information but also contribute to a more organized and stress-free travel experience. As you explore Dubai's diverse attractions, let your focus be on creating memories, knowing that your travel essentials are protected and easily accessible.
